SolarFun Power Holdings Opens Connecticut Office

Solarfun Power Holdings Co., Ltd. a Chinese manufacturer of silicon ingots, wafers and photovoltaic cells and modules, said it is opening a new office in Cheshire, Connecticut, the company’s second location in North America. Solarfun also maintains a facility in Costa Mesa, California.

Green-e Energy Sales of Renewable Power Continues Double Digit Growth

The Center for Resource Solutions (CRS) has released its 2009 Green-e Verification Report, which highlights Green-e Energy certified renewable energy and carbon-offset sales in 2009. The report shows a 43% increase in total Green-e Energy sales volume over the previous year, equivalent to over 18 million MWh of renewable energy generation. According to the National [...]
